Description
The Steelworkers’ Archives is collaborating with Lehigh University on a Mellon Foundation funded digital archive project. The Women of Bethlehem Steel project aims to collect stories of women’s experiences as workers, wives, store owners, managers, and clerical workers at Bethlehem Steel or in the surrounding neighborhoods. This project will produce a digital archive available for researchers, students, and curious people to learn more about women’s roles related to Bethlehem Steel.
This event will consist of a slide show of women at the Steel, an explanation of the project by representatives from Lehigh University and the Steelworkers’ Archives, and a mediated panel of women affiliated with the Steel.
Panel participants will include: union women who worked on the shop floor, a wife of a steelworker, a woman who worked in management, and a woman whose parents ran a South Side grocery store with a steelworking customer base.
